En effekt körs igen baserat på dess beroenden, och att få den arrayen fel är källan till #1 React-buggar.
Varför det är viktigt
En effekt stänger sig över värdena från den rendering den skapades i. Om du utelämnar ett beroende använder den fortsatt ett gammalt:
( {
id = ( {
.(count);
}, );
(id);
}, []);
